Description:
pinepgp - Automates the pgp sign, encrypt and decrypt functions within pine
Changes:
pinepgp (2.1) unstable; urgency=low
.
* Fixed the new check to handle empthy headders correctly
* Cleaned up some line breaks in the changelog
* Andy Mortimer <andy.mortimer@poboxes.com> preformed the following changes:
o use sed rather than grep/expr/head to extract the beginning and end
of the original message, for a rather large speedup.
o test the file to ensure it's not already decrypted (the previous
version would trigger on the -----BEGIN PGP DECRYPTED MESSAGE----- in
a forwarded email)
o stop the decryption function from sending the same output twice to
the console
o explicitly state that a key is trusted, rather than just saying `good
sig' without a comment
